Pokemon GIF: Dragonite

My obsession of Pokemon from childhood has seeped through the cracks of my adulthood. In order to grow in your field of work, you have to constantly practice and find new challenges. By creating my favorite Pokemon in Adobe Illustrator and animating them in Adobe After Effects, I can expand my skills and still have fun doing it.

Dragonite consists of 6 basic parts: Eyes, Head, Body, Legs, Wings, and Tail. I first designed each element onto their own separate layers in Illustrator, then imported the .ai document into After Effects. The biggest challenge was to animate the wings without having to create several rotoscoped versions to give it a 3D look.
